10 Shops fined TK 67,500 in Rajshahi

RAJSHAHI, Jan 3, 2018 (BSS) – Bangladesh Standard and Testing Institution (BSTI) fined a total of 10 shop-owners in the region Taka 67,500 in last month for selling and manufacturing adulterated food items.

BSTI regional office in association with respective district administration conducted seven mobile courts and found selling of substandard and unhygienic food items violating BSTI rules and regulations.

The court also realised Taka 67,500 from the shop owners during the drive.

Altab Hossain, Director of BSTI, here today said the regional office has stepped up its drives against the manufacturer of substandard and adulterated food items. Such drives will continue in the days to come for the greater interest of the people, he said.

The BSTI regional office also conducted 28 surveillance/squad drives for prevention of pilferage in weight and measurement and using of formalin in fruit and fish, the official added.
